How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Queens?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| Queens Studio Apartments | $3,819 | $1,200 | $10,000+ |
| Queens 1 Bedroom Apartments | $4,267 | $900 | $10,000+ |
| Queens 2 Bedroom Apartments | $5,362 | $2,000 | $10,000+ |
| Queens 3 Bedroom Apartments | $5,492 | $1,500 | $10,000+ |
| Queens 4 Bedroom Apartments | $5,850 | $1,695 | $10,000+ |
| Queens 5 Bedroom Apartments | $7,466 | $3,700 | $10,000+ |

Frequently Asked Questions about 2 Bedroom Queens Apartments
What is the Cheapest apartment in Queens with 2 Bedroom?
Currently the most affordable 2 Bedroom in Queens is at Arverne View listed at $2,199.
How much is the average rent for a 2 Bedroom Queens Apartment?
The average rent for a 2 Bedroom Apartment in Queens is $5,362.
What is the largest available 2 Bedroom Queens Apartment for rent?
Today's apartment with the most square footage in Queens is a 1,442 square feet unit at Two Blue Slip.
What is the average size for Queens 2 Bedroom Apartments for rent?
The average size for a 2 Bedroom rental in Queens is currently 1,036 sq ft.
